Wood is an organic element that requires proper care. If you’re the type of person that wants to “buy and forget”, you better opt for plastic or aluminum window blinds – it requires much less maintenance; of course, you’d also be saying goodbye to all the style you could achieve with wooden blinds. However, keeping your wood blinds in perfect shape isn’t that hard, and it is something that will only take a few minutes of your time from time to time.
Unlike wood that is exposed to the outside environment – thus requiring much greater care – those in your wooden window blinds are mostly protected from the adverse weather conditions. They’ll mostly have to endure exposure to the sun and heat. That’s something you can easily treat with the appropriate products. However, you won’t have to deal with it for a long time.
